| Episode narrativeepisode_narrative | Cold and dry high pressure built across the region behind a strong cold front. Strong cold air advection through the day and radiational cooling under clear skies and calm winds that night allowed several locations across the northwest Florida peninsula to fall below freezing for several hours. |
| Event narrativeevent_narrative | Minimum temperatures were generally around 30 across the county, with the RAWS station 12 miles southwest of Chiefland reporting 27 degrees and the FAWN station in Bronson reaching 32. The lowest temperature recorded was 26 degrees at the cooperative station 6 miles southeast of Chiefland. The average duration of below freezing temperatures was 5 hours, with up to 8 hours in isolated locations. |
